Output 34dfa5f249b1d77846fc5a2a0bc7dff5b866f5467d535ee87b27bced5204f9ba:1

value
1026820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b51a79b2469df6b5f92a709e603541f1d31bfd OP_EQUAL
address
3FRtEc1niKbsNxc3naPYCFXnGYioPZXL8P
transaction
34dfa5f249b1d77846fc5a2a0bc7dff5b866f5467d535ee87b27bced5204f9ba
spent
true